Abstract

The synthesis of ethylene-co-5,7-dimethylocta-1,6-diene copolymers (CEDMO) with different molar DMO contents has been performed to incorporate double bonds in the lateral and make easier the development of crosslinkings in the resulting polymer material after application of electron-beam irradiation. The gel content as well as a comprehensive evaluation of the changes in the crystalline characteristics have been carried out. Both features are strongly dependent on DMO composition and irradiation doses.
